Left-wing filmmaker Michael Moore said he cannot accept the privileges of 'full citizenship' until Roe v. Wade is reinstated and "every single Republican is removed from office."

The 68-year-old said recent events upset his tranquility.

Moore said he spends every waking moment nagging people he meets about the issues which have inflamed him.

Moore summed up his frustrations in a posting on Twitter with the title: "A mass shooting to celebrate the 4th."

"A wealthy class that doubled its wealth while the country suffered," it continued.

"A Supreme Court that stripped 51% of our citizens of their reproductive rights while removing gun laws & killing the EPA,"  it read.

Moore then turned his attention to the numerous shootings of black Americans which have occurred in recent times.

Moore claims he is standing up for oft-touted American values of 'Life, Liberty and the Pursuit of Happiness' but he notes how unsettled he has become following recent events.

"I refuse to live in a country threatened by white supremacy," Moore said.

"And I'm not leaving," he began before railing at the recent decision made by the Supreme Court to overturn women's abortion rights.

"So we've got a problem," he said.

"I cannot in good conscience continue to receive the privileges of 'full citizenship' in this land when all of its women and girls have now been declared official second-class citizens with no rights to their own bodies and conscripted to a life of Forced Birth should they fall pregnant and not want to be," Moore continued as she commiserated following the overturning of the 1973 court ruling.

"I demand an end to the mass incarceration of Black Americans, an end to police shooting Black people."

"And I demand that reparations be made to the Black community for all they currently have to suffer and endure," Moore proposed.

Moore also made the demand that all Republicans be forced out.

"I insist we remove every single Republican from office in November. The Republican Party has dismantled itself and its remaining rogue elements now exist purely to overturn legitimate election results and overthrow the elected will of the vast majority of the American people," he said.

"This must be halted without delay or equivocation," he said.

"If you invite me to dinner that's all I'm gonna talk about. Have me over to your party ... and I won't stop until Roe is reinstated and 51% of Congress is female," he teased.
